Customer Service Representative

Customer service representatives handle phone calls and email messages for companies in a variety of industries. They use their knowledge about company products and services in order to answer customer questions, resolve issues, and drive sales by recommending new or upgraded products and services. They record their interactions, as well as creating new client records and managing digital support tickets.

These professionals often work from home jobs uk from call centers and customer contact centres, but a growing number of at-home jobs are available. Companies like Alorica@Home and Direct Interactions hire independent contractors to assist customers via telephone. These jobs require a landline phone, a computer running Windows 7 or later with high-speed Internet access and a headset. A high school diploma is required, along with training on the job. Candidates must be reliable, self-motivated and great communicators who are comfortable resolving problems for customers.

The pay of customer service representatives is typically $10 or more per hour, however the number of hours worked may differ. Some companies only require one shift whereas others may require two shifts. Alorica@Home allows flexible scheduling, benefits, and medical coverage, for example.

Data Entry Clerk

Data entry clerks working from home can earn minimum wage and, if experienced, as high as $20 an hour. This position is not as flexible as other remote jobs, but it can provide an income that is steady for those who need regular cash flow. This position also provides good experience for people who want to move into other remote jobs, like bookkeeping or proofreading.

The education requirements for a data entry clerk vary according to the industry and company. Most employers will accept a high school diploma however, some might require an associate or bachelor's. Virtual Assistant

If you're an administrative assistant with previous experience and would prefer to work from home, you should consider the position of Virtual Assistant (VA). VAs are responsible for a variety of tasks including scheduling meetings, arranging accommodation for travel, organizing digital files, responding to phone calls and emails and offering general assistance to their clients. VAs typically have a high-speed internet connection and headset. They should also be able to prioritize and manage multiple tasks under tight deadlines.

You can find work as a freelancer on sites like Upwork and oDesk to begin your career in VA. You can bid on projects and earn the agreed-upon rate in the event that you are successful. If you're a novice, your initial rates might be low, but with hard work and regular performance, you'll be able to earn more than the typical salary for virtual assistants.

In addition, you can search for virtual assistant jobs in Facebook groups for small companies, or on LinkedIn. LinkedIn lets you fill out a professional profile that showcases your skills and experiences and connect with other small-business owners in need of assistance.

Many websites are devoted to matching people with remote VA positions. Some of these websites require you to sign up for an account, while others do not. Fancy Hands Upwork and Virtual Gal Friday are just two of these websites. Fancy Hands hires only experienced virtual assistants. Upwork and oDesk offer an array of jobs that are entry-level.

Social Media Manager

A work-from-home social media manager job concentrates on managing a company's web presence across all platforms, including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n and even Tik Tok. This includes writing and analyzing content, implementing and developing strategies for social media, and managing clients. This job is commonplace in large companies, but also in small and medium-sized enterprises and agencies that specialize in marketing through social media.

A social media manager may be a full-time or freelance job, and responsibilities vary according to the industry and the size of the team. In general, an ideal candidate for this position should have a strong writing ability, excellent attention to details and the ability to convey a brand's message or product features to their customers. A social media manager must be proficient on all platforms and be able to learn new skills and face new challenges.
